What is c3 c4 pathway? what are the differences between them?

In C3 pathway the primary acceptor of CO2 is 5 carbon Ribulose 1_5 bisphosphste and in C4 pathway the primaty acceptor of Co2 is 3 carbon compound phospho eonl pyruvic acid

In c3 pathway photorespiration occurs and in c4 plants photorespiration doesn't occur.
